Reksaari
An island retreat with the spirit of archipelago lifestyle. Here, hiking trails through nature meet the experiences offered by saunas and restaurants.


Reksaari is a perfect destination for a summer day with the whole family. Located just a short boat ride from the mainland, the island combines an authentic archipelago atmosphere with a wide range of services. Built around the old Karttu island farm, the area has preserved its traditional character while offering comfortable amenities for modern visitors.
On the island, you can enjoy a relaxing day in nature, take a dip in the sea after a sauna, join summer events, or stay overnight surrounded by beautiful archipelago scenery. Services include Restaurant Kapteenien Salakapakka, play areas for children, and the Wanha sauna – once even ranked as the second-best sauna in Finland.
Reksaari’s hiking trails wind through diverse island landscapes, offering the chance to explore local flora, birdlife, and scenic sea views. The routes are suitable for the whole family and provide peaceful nature experiences.
You can reach the island by private boat, water taxi, or charter transport from the Rauma region. Reksaari is an excellent day-trip destination, but for those wishing to stay longer, accommodation is available, for example at the Rohela reservable hut.
